Output 91dcf84f45e5624d0c0ae5264c7f8c8bbcd85fbef8e63a67be156dc960dcad77:0

value
38513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ded8864b3693153393c859f46f588dad5676335 OP_EQUAL
address
37LThK6N9VUjsBRsaAQRba2bU5bg1shmhZ
transaction
91dcf84f45e5624d0c0ae5264c7f8c8bbcd85fbef8e63a67be156dc960dcad77
spent
true